36% of them took place in long-term care facilities. In some states, that percentage was as high as 54%. Hundreds of thousands of senior citizens and caretakers will never be seen again.While the elderly and those with health conditions were uniquely susceptible last year to infection, the conscious choices of nursing homes made the casualties worse.
In cases of viral infection, residents were given ineffective antibiotic treatments.The ban on family members visiting residents did not have the desired effects as nursing home workers became major spreaders of the disease.
Due to these failures and more, nursing homes have a worse reputation than ever. 1 in 2 Americans harbor more negative feelings towards nursing homes now than they did in.
